Walter M. Dallman
Adjutant
Adjutant Walter M. Dallman was mustered into the US service
at Syracuse, NY, September 18, 1862 at the age of 28 under a commission as
Adjutant dated October 4, 1862, rank August 29, 1862.
He was wounded slightly in the throat at Lookout Mountain,
Tennessee on November 24, 1863 and in the thigh and hand slightly at Ringgold,
Georgia on November 27, 1863.
He was discharged on March 15, 1865 to accept a promotion
on the staff of General Fenton.
Brevetted Major NY Volunteers.
